The Crookston Pirates Girl’s Tennis team was missing three players in their starting line up but continue to show off their depth with a 5-2 victory over the Park Rapids Panthers in a Section 8A matchup in Park Rapids.
Singles
Crookston won two of the four singles matches. At first singles, Catherine Tiedemann ran into an outstanding player in Abby Morris and lost in straight sets. Emma Osborn continues her outstanding play and showed some grit in her match. She lost 7-6 and 7-5 in the tie-breaker before winning the next two sets 6-3, 6-3 to earn the win. Brekken Tull had another rollercoaster match with a 6-0 win in the first set, a 6-1 loss in the second set before she won the third set 6-4 for the victory.
At fourth singles, Crookston eighth-grader Addie Fee was playing her first varsity singles match and won the first set 6-2, but lost the next two sets.
Doubles –
Crookston swept all three doubles matches. At first dubs, Hannah Lindemoen and Abby Borowicz cruised to a victory while outscoring their opponents 12-2. The second doubles team of Halle Bruggeman and Emma Gunderson won a hard-fought match 6-4, 7-5. At third doubles, Macy Fee and Isabelle Smith won 6-4, 6-4.
Crookston improves to 8-1 on the year and will travel to Thief River Falls on Tuesday and wrap up the regular season on Saturday, October 3 at Roseau. The Section 8A Girls Tennis tournament will start Tuesday, October 6. For the Section 8A Girls Tennis tournament schedule click here.
